Once on-site, our team dust sheet the bathroom floor, toilet, sink, warming appliances, and key sections of the bathroom.
We meticulously scrub the bath with high-quality bath-safe products and eliminate old, degraded sealant.
We restore and fix imperfections, such as minor cracks and chipped enamel, abrasions, calcium buildup, and worn away enamel from hard water. If the base of your bath has cracks or holes, our specialists will ensure a flawless finish.
We cover the surrounding tiles, vertical surfaces, water outlets, waste, and overflow with masking to avoid any coating residue.
We utilize a professional-grade cleaning agent to eliminate any grease, surface contaminants, etc..
Then we spray on the second bonding agent with a hot air gun. Unlike other bath re enamelling companies we use two bonding agents so the enamel surface we spray on has a very strong hold to the original surface.
We proceed by spraying the second bonding agent for maximum surface adhesion.Unlike standard refinishing providers, we use two bonding agents, allowing the reglazed bath has a very strong hold to the original surface.
Our team utilizes an specialized infrared drying technology to ensure a durable, long-lasting finish and clear away all masking materials.
We then perfect the final details, bringing out a smooth, high-gloss effect to ensure a like-new appearance.
Finally, we apply a fresh silicone seal so your newly resurfaced bath is protected.

Our knowledge allows us to know whether a bigger problem may be hiding in plain sight.When a cast iron or pressed steel bath is made, it is coated with an extremely hard and durable layer of enamel.
This protective enamel layer is fused onto the bath’s surface at extreme heat levels and hardens during cooling to create a shiny, glass-like effect.Absolutely!
